网页设计制作,CSS实现隔行换色两种方法:
第一种方法:
以下为引用的内容:
<style type="text/css">
UL.myul1 LI{background-color: expression(this.sourceIndex%2==0?'#9FB7F6':'#B6C8F8');
}
</style>
<ul class="myul1">
<li id="li1">111</li>
<li id="li2">222</li>
<li id="li2">333</li>
<li id="li2">444</li>
<li id="li2">555</li>
<li id="li2">666</li>
</ul> |
第二种方法:
以下为引用的内容:
<style type="text/css">
<!--
.li01 { background:#FFF; }
.li02 { background:#000; }
li a{width:100%;display:block;}
li a:hover{background:red;}
-->
</style>
<div id="list01"><ul>
<li class="title"><a href="#">title</a></li>
<li><a href="#">111</a></li>
<li><a href="#">222</a></li>
<li><a href="#">333</a></li>
<li><a href="#">444</a></li>
<li><a href="#">555</a></li>
<li><a href="#">666</a></li>
</ul></div>
<script Language="Javascript1.2">
objName=document.getElementById("list01").getElementsByTagName("li")
for (i=0;i<objName.length;i++) {
(i%2==0)?(objName(i).className = "li01"):(objName(i).className = "li02");
}
</script>
分享到:
相关推荐
CSS结合JavaScript 实现Li隔行换色 代码
以前在Dreamweaver中用表格布局网页的时候常常用到一种设计手法–隔行换色。也就是新闻列表或是列表类的每隔一行就换另一个色彩这样显得很漂亮也很合适阅读。所以这种手法被广大的设计师们收入囊中作为自己的又一把...
jquery table ui插件制作css表格隔行变色特效代码
css+js隔行换色,很实用的代码。喜欢 的快来用吧,新手赚积分拉~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
【Web网页设计制作-毕业设计期末大作业】HTML、CSS、JavaScript前端网页项目源码【Web网页设计制作-毕业设计期末大作业】HTML、CSS、JavaScript前端网页项目源码【Web网页设计制作-毕业设计期末大作业】HTML、CSS、...
CSS隔行换色的问题,其实很简单,您可以根据您的需要,采用下面的任何一种方法,当然,要适合你的编码与需求情况:一、background背景图片 如果行高固定的话,推荐使用背景图,也推荐将行高固定!兼容一切浏览器。...
CSS expression 隔行换色效果实现代码,需要的朋友可以参考下。
CSS&javascript动态网页设计与制作CSS&javascript动态网页设计与制作CSS&javascript动态网页设计与制作CSS&javascript动态网页设计与制作CSS&javascript动态网页设计与制作CSS&javascript动态网页设计与制作CSS&...
css expression 隔行换色
CSS2实现的隔行换色
本文实例讲述了JS+CSS实现Li列表隔行换色效果的方法。分享给大家供大家参考。具体实现方法如下: 代码如下:<!DOCTYPE html PUBLIC “-//W3C//DTD XHTML 1.0 Transitional//EN” ...
主要介绍了使用JavaScript和CSS实现文本隔行换色的方法,当然最普通的也可以单纯用CSS实现,需要的朋友可以参考下
今天用一种简洁的方法toggleClass()实现了隔行换色:代码如下: 代码如下: <!DOCTYPE HTML> <html> <head> <meta charset=”utf-8″> <title>隔行换色</title> [removed][removed] ...
【Web网页设计制作-毕业设计期末大作业】HTML、CSS、JavaScript前端网页项目源码【Web网页设计制作-毕业设计期末大作业】HTML、CSS、JavaScript前端网页项目源码【Web网页设计制作-毕业设计期末大作业】HTML、CSS、...
既然你都知道是隔行换色了,那就隔行换色就是了。方法很多。 最直接的在每一行的上直接加bgcolor=”red”。 用css的话就定义行二个颜色的类。在每一行交替使用这个类就是了。如: tr class=”trClass1″ tr class=...